I’m leaving my current job and immediately starting a new one. I’m essentially maxing out my current 401k (just shy of 19k/ yr) and will definitely at my next one. When I leave, I will get a big PTO payout and I assume extra will go into my current 401k. I’m going to roll that over and then max out my new employer (the full 19.5k in 10.5 months). I assume when I do my 2021 taxes I will have an excess contribution? What will happen then? Will I have to pull money back out? Or will it matter?

Don’t do this. When you start your new employer plan they will ask about 2021 contributions to your old plan. If you make an excess contribution it’s a moderate hassle to have the funds withdrawn, and also causes extra tax paperwork. Much better to just manage your total 2021 contributions to the 19.5k limit
